SunFounder PiDog Kit, Release 1.0
3.5 Dual Touch Sensor
Dual channel touch sensor, based on two ttp223 touch sensors. When a touch signal is detected, the corresponding pin
level will be pulled low.
TTP223 is a touch pad detector IC that provides 1 touch key. The touch detection IC is specially designed to replace
the traditional direct keys with different pad sizes. It features low power consumption and wide operating voltage.
Specifications
Power Supply: 2.0V~5.5V
Signal Output: Digital signal
Connector: SH1.0 4P
Pin Out
GND - Ground Input
VCC - Power Supply Input
SIG1 - Touch signal 1, low level means touch
SIG2 - Touch signal 2, low level means touch
3.6 11-channel Light Board
This is an 11-channel RGB LED module, which is equipped with 11 RGB LEDs controlled by the SLED1735 chip.
SLED1734 can drive up to 256 LEDs and 75 RGB LEDs. In the LED matrix controlled by SLED1734, each LED has
on/off, blinking, breathing light and automatic synchronization and many other functions. The chip has built-in PWM
(pulse width modulation) technology, which can provide 256 levels of brightness adjustment. It also has a 16-level dot
correction function.
